+ "phpunit/phpunit": "^5.0 || ^8.5.14",
+ "phpunit/phpunit-selenium": "*",
+ "yoast/phpunit-polyfills": "*",
+ "ext-curl": "*",
+ "ext-dom": "*",
+ "ext-mbstring": "*",
+ "ext-xsl": "*",
+ "indeyets/pake": "^1.99",
+ "docbook/docbook-xsl": "^1.79"
+ },
+ "suggest": {
+ "ext-curl": "Needed for HTTPS and HTTP 1.1 support, NTLM Auth etc...",
+ "ext-zlib": "Needed for sending compressed requests and receiving compressed responses, if cURL is not available",
+ "ext-mbstring": "Needed to allow reception of requests/responses in character sets other than ASCII,LATIN-1,UTF-8",
+ "phpxmlrpc/extras": "Adds more featured Server classes and other useful bits",
+ "phpxmlrpc/jsonrpc": "Adds support for the JSON-RPC protocol",
+ "sami/sami": "Required for doc generation using pake. Version constraints: ^3.3 || ^4.1"
+ },
+ "_comment::conflict": "Within the extras package, only the XMLRPC extension emulation is not compatible... the JSONRPC part should be ok. Both have been moved to different packages anyway",
+ "conflict": {
+ "phpxmlrpc/extras": "<= 0.6.3"